January 30-February 5, 2003 artpicks Face Time
Joyce Tenneson has had everyone from Eve Ensler to Coretta Scott King to Ed Harris pose for her. She's done dozens of covers for publications such as Time and Vogue. And she's photographed less recognizable folks, too, such as a group of Spelman College graduates and mother-and-daughter duos. Her latest book of photography is Wise Women, a collection of images of women from ages 65 to 100, and it's a stunner. Tenneson, known for her ability to give her subjects great character, has succeeded in making these women shine in front of her lens. Pentimenti asked Tenneson to choose two artists to complement her show of old and new work. She chose the late photographer Abigail R. Cohen, a local artist who passed away in 2000 yet at the age of 27 had proven herself to have great talent and insight into her craft. A book of her work, One Cycle of My Journey, includes thoughts by Tenneson and Mary Ellen Mark (with both of whom Cohen worked). Tenneson also chose Michael Goesele, a young photographer and graphic artist, to show his more conceptual, shadowy work; Goesele also designed Cohen's book. A warm sense of kismet accompanies this show, as the diversity of the work is both complemented and intensified by the personal connections among the artists. “Face to Face” reception and book-signing Thu., Jan. 30, 6-8 p.m.; exhibit runs Jan. 30-Feb. 28, Pentimenti Gallery, 133 N. Third St., 215-625-9990.
